NASA Centennial Challenges directly engage the public in the process of advanced technology development. The program offers incentive prizes to generate revolutionary solutions to problems of interest to NASA and the nation. Learn how to access these opportunities for students of all ages while getting a sneak peek at the Space Robotics Challenge Phase 2.
